    Mortal Kombat 11 Aftermath Expansion Adds More Story, New Character

    Game studio NetherRealm Studios recently revealed the next additional content for popular action fighting game Mortal Kombat 11.

    Mortal Kombat 11 Aftermath is not a character pack

    The expansion pack is titled Aftermath and it will be a post-launch story for the main one. It will be released this month, May 26, and it will not just new characters to the game, there will be a new story to follow.

    Aftermath will be the story after Liu Kang defeats Kronika and then together with Raiden would have already rebooted the universe when all of a sudden Shan Tsung appears to halt their progress. He reveals that if they continue that the effects would be catastrophic. This is where the story continues with a small arc.

    This new expansion will introduce three new characters for the large cast. There will be two returning ones, Fujin and Sheeva. They will have major roles in the new story. The new one is the surprise: Robocop with his classic look.

    Aftermath will also add new character skins, a new update adding new stages, stage fatalities, friendships, and many more.

    The game is already available on PlayStation 4, Xbox One, PC, Nintendo Switch, and Google Stadia.
